merrill newman reportedly served in a secret unit during the war. information about the operation was was declassified in the early '90s when a retired colonel started writing a book about it. the unit was said to have trained anti-communist gur ril las to fight behind enemy lines. this photo reportedly shows newman posing with former gur ril las. one said newman trained him. a political science professor says it does not matter why they detained him. what matters is that they did. >> what matters is that they now have a bargaining chip vis-a-vis the u.s. government. although no one's going to say outlewd that's what it is, i'm quite certain that both sides know exactly that's what it is. >> according to reuters, newman went to south korea twice in the past decade, but this was his first known trip to the north. >>> vice president joe biden will stop in south korea this week during his week-long visit to asia. as of now, there's no word whether he's discuss or meet with anyone regarding merrill newman and his arrest in north korea. the vice presiden

lillian. >> merrill newman's role in the white tiger to train anti-communist guerrillas. this photo shows him posing with some of the members in south korea decades after the korean war. newman reportedly visited south korea twice in the past ten years. in his videotaped apology released by north korean state media friday night, newman accepts responsibility for helping anti-communist guerrillas. the guerrilla unit was called a regiment named after a north korean mountain where the guerrillas sought refuge. many are now questioning why newman went to north korea given his role during the korean war. one fellow white tiger believes newman went to do a favor for his former guerrillas. >> i think some of those people indicated they may have had relatives still living in north korea, and they probably asked him would he try to find those and maybe talk to those people and let them know what the condition of their family was, so the results of that, that led to him seeking some of those people in north korea and relating to those people picking them up off the plane and detain

. >>> merrill newman held captive more than a month in north korea said he was kept in a hotel, not a jail cell. the 85-year-old palo alto man spoke to the santa cruz sentinel today. he said he was well fed and kept comfortable. when asked about the apology that was broadcasted earlier this week, newman said that's not my english. he added his wife is now in charge of his passport. newman returned to the bay area yesterday. >>> this afternoon a medical team from stanford hospital returned from the philippines. the team spent two weeks providing medical help in the region which was hard hit by typhoon haiyan. in their first four days they spent more than 2500 patients. on average they saw several hundred people a day at vier us where clinics throughout the affected reg -- at various clinics throughout at affected region. witnesses and experts will be questioned in washington this week to -- >>> witnesses and experts will be questioned in be with washington this week to find out -- in washington this week to find it out what happened with the plane issue at sfo. a report in the chronicl

veteran merrill newman is letting the world know about his ordeal after being captured there. his ordeal turned into more than a month in captivity. the report showed he had entered their country in their words, with "wrong understanding of it." and hostile acts against it, that act was to reminisce too much about his time during the war and whether he could speak to any surviving north korean counterparts. he explains "north koreans have misinterpreted my curiosity as something more sinister. as something more sinister. he disavowed that so-called confession and apology that the north koreans made him videotape, saying he would be threatened with a long prison sentence inif he did not cooperate. he is fortunate to be home. and the tourist named kenneth bae is also in prison there. like newman, he entered the country lawfully on a visa. unlike newman, he was detained more than a year ago. tried, convicted and sentenced in may to 15 years hard labor. he is still there. us now. i can't imagine what is going through your mind, i know you're clearly happy for the newman family but
